USS Talos (NCC-97409), originally named USS Achilles, is a Federation Echelon-class light cruiser assigned to the Fourth Fleet. Intended to complete a two-month shakedown cruise under the command of Captain Akintoye Okusanya following her launch in 2401, as Achilles, she was pressed into service during the Lost Fleet crisis. Later, she was used as the engineering support vessel for the reactivation of the mothballed Achilles-class starships, and in 2402, the name was transferred back to the prototype of that class, and NCC-97409 was renamed Talos.

History

Built at Avalon Fleet Yards, Achilles was launched in 2401 and placed under the command of Captain Akintoye Okusanya for a shakedown cruise due to her engineering expertise and experience with Arcturus Squadron. Not long after her launch, Achilles experienced her baptism of fire at the Battle of Farpoint, where she participated alongside the other vessels of Arcturus Squadron.[1]

For the remainder of the year, Achilles was stationed at Avalon Fleet Yards, where she supported to reactivation of the mothballed Achilles-class destroyer. She was specifically selected for this role to serve as a cover for the operation because of the shared name. When the previous Achilles was recommissioned in 2402, the Echelon-class vessel was renamed Talos.
